#ad36e3 is a balanced electric violet, 281° on the wheel and 60/100 on the cool side. Put white text on it (4.76:1). As text it scores 4.76:1 on white — safe at any size. Nearest name is Dark Orchid, nearest Tailwind family is purple.

Large text — 24px regular or 18.66px bold and above — only needs 3:1, so #AD36E3 is enough for headings on white. Non-text elements such as icons, chart strokes and focus rings also sit at 3:1 under WCAG 2.2 (1.4.11).

Roughly one man in twelve has some form of colour vision deficiency. If any of the three panels above is hard to tell apart from a neighbouring colour in your palette, add a shape, an icon or a label so the meaning does not rest on hue alone.

The same eleven steps expressed in OKLCH, where equal lightness numbers actually look equally spaced. HSL ramps go muddy in the yellows and washed out in the blues; this one does not. Modern browsers render it natively — the hex ramp above is the fallback.

#ad36e3, answered

What color is #ad36e3?

#ad36e3 is a balanced electric violet, closest to Dark Orchid (ΔE2000 5). It sits at 281° on the hue wheel with 76% saturation and 55% lightness, which reads as cool.

What is the RGB value of #ad36e3?

rgb(173, 54, 227) — 173 red, 54 green and 227 blue out of 255, or 67.8% / 21.2% / 89% by channel.

What is #ad36e3 in HSL and HSV?

hsl(281, 76%, 55%) and hsv(281, 76%, 89%). HSL is what CSS takes; HSV is what your design tool's picker shows, which is why the saturation numbers rarely match.

Is #ad36e3 a light or a dark color?

It is a dark color. Relative luminance is 0.1707 and perceived brightness is 50%, so white text on it reaches 4.76:1.

Should I use black or white text on #ad36e3?

White. It scores 4.76:1 against #ad36e3, versus 4.41:1 for black — AA at any size.

Is #ad36e3 accessible on a white background?

#ad36e3 on white scores 4.76:1, which clears AA at every size but not AAA.

What is the complementary color of #ad36e3?

#6CE336 sits directly opposite on the wheel. Softer options are the split-complements #C2E336 and #36E357, which give the same contrast with far less vibration.

What colors go well with #ad36e3?

For interface work: #F9F4FA as the surface, #DFC0ED for borders, #824B9B for secondary text, #70B715 as an accent and #521070 for hover and pressed states. For a palette, the analogous pair #5736E3 and #E336C2 stays calm, while #6CE336 is the loudest partner.

What is #ad36e3 in CMYK for printing?

cmyk(24%, 76%, 0%, 11%). This is a screen-to-ink approximation — a color this saturated sits outside most CMYK gamuts and will print duller than it looks here.

Is #ad36e3 warm or cool?

Cool — it scores 60 on a scale where 0 is the warmest orange and 100 the coolest azure. Nudged warmer it becomes #E336D9; nudged cooler, #6D34E5.

Which Tailwind color is closest to #ad36e3?

The purple family — its 500 step is #a855f7, ΔE2000 6.5 away. That is a visible difference, so define #ad36e3 as a custom token rather than reaching for the built-in.

How do I use #ad36e3 in Tailwind CSS?

Inline it as an arbitrary value with bg-[#ad36e3] or text-[#ad36e3], or register the whole ramp under theme.extend.colors.brand so you get bg-brand-500 and friends. The generated 50–950 scale on this page is ready to paste into your config.

What is #ad36e3 with 50% opacity?

rgba(173, 54, 227, 0.5), or #ad36e380 in eight-digit hex. Over white that composites to #D69BF1; over black, #571B72.

Is #ad36e3 a web-safe color?

No. The nearest web-safe colour is #9933CC, ΔE2000 5 away. The palette only matters for legacy displays and some email clients now.

What does the color #ad36e3 mean?

As a violet, it reads creative, premium, modern. Violet sits between the warmth of red and the calm of blue, so it reads as inventive without reading as risky. Current shorthand for software craft. At this chroma the effect is amplified — it will dominate whatever sits beside it.

What gradient works with #ad36e3?

The safest is same-hue elevation: linear-gradient(135deg, #C36CEA, #ad36e3 45%, #521070). For more colour, a short hue run to #DC1F89 keeps it rich without turning muddy.
